Fill in the blanks:You need to figure out your_____before you can implement a_____.
Choose an answer
Tap an option to check your answer.
Correct answer: process,technology.
Why this is the answer
The correct answer is"process,technology."Before implementing any technology,it's essential to have a clear understanding of the processes that it will support or enhance.Processes outline the series of steps,actions,and work flows involved in achieving specific objectives or tasks within an organization.By defining and optimizing processes first,businesses can ensure that they have a solid foundation and framework in place to guide the selection,implementation,and utilization of technology effectively.Once the processes are well-defined,businesses can then identify and implement the appropriate technology solutions to support and automate these processes,maximizing efficiency,productivity,and effectiveness.Attempting to implement technology without first understanding the underlying processes can lead to inefficiencies,misalignment,and ultimately, failed technology initiatives.Therefore,prioritizing the definition and optimization of processes before implementing technology is critical for ensuring successful technology adoption and maximizing its impact on business operations and outcomes.
